About Organisation:
Food for the Hungry (FH/U) is a Christian international relief and development organization that has been working in Uganda since 1989. FH is currently operating programs in Asia, Latin America and Africa with support offices in the UK, Canada, Switzerland, Sweden, United States of America and Japan. FH’s primary goal is to end all forms of poverty World-wide. In Uganda, FH is operational in the Districts of Adjumani, Kitgum, Lamwo, Kole, Kween, Mbale, Namutumba and Amudat Districts implementing programs in four main sectors of Education; Food Security and Livelihoods; Health/Nutrition and Disaster Risk Reduction; with the Head office located in Kampala.
Job Summary: The Emergency Health and Nutrition Officer (EHNO) will oversee emergency health and nutrition response interventions including coordinating emergency preparedness and response plans, conducting assessments, planning and implementing health and nutrition interventions, monitoring and evaluating program effectiveness, providing technical guidance and support to staff and partners, liaising with government agencies and other stakeholders, and ensuring compliance with relevant standards and guidelines and FH Disaster response plan. He/she will also support regular review of project plans and adjustment in the case of any other evolving public health emergencies and natural hazard-caused calamities. ERT members are full-time staff who have other roles within FH’s regular program that are trained and equipped to respond to emergencies. FH can also engage experienced or trained contractors and partners as part of the ERT
